The Rise of Stablecoin Salaries

Stablecoins like USDC and USDT are gaining traction for payroll. They keep their value steady, which is a big plus for employees who don’t want the wild price swings that come with traditional c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in. By offering salaries in stablecoins, companies can give employees a reliable payment method, making it appealing for both sides.

Risks and Challenges of Crypto Payroll

But it’s not all sunshine and rainbows. There are hurdles to jump over. Regulatory uncertainty is a big one. Then there’s the volatility of cryptocurrencies, which could cause headaches for companies lacking the infrastructure to manage it. And let’s not forget security concerns—the irreversible nature of blockchain transactions can lead to losses if mishandled.
